Fred Lee is a professional social butterfly . By day , he works as the Director of Alumni Engagement for the University of British Columbia . By night , he writes for various publications , talks on the radio and hosts redcarpet galas and fundraisers .
Favourite restaurants Joshua [ McVeity , Lee ’ s husband ] and I do not cook , so we eat out a lot . Whenever there ’ s a birthday or anniversary , we celebrate at Hawksworth . The food is always outstanding . We also like Nightingale . It ’ s much more casual . And we love Bacchus . And Tableau — we go there for brunch all the time . Cactus Club is a go-to for casual fine dining . And Homer St . Cafe . For seafood , Joe Fortes . In terms of Asian , we love Bao Bei , Torafuku , Miku . And of course Maenam and Vij ’ s .
Favourite places for a drink Bacchus , because the room is stunning . Nearby is also Yew . Lauren Mote designed the cocktail list there . And we like Notch8 .
Favourite clothing store For me , it ’ s a one-stop shop at Harry Rosen , because everything is there . I also find the service outstanding .
Favourite shoe store I will go everywhere for shoes — Harry Rosen , or the men ’ s department at Nordstrom . There are also some neat boutique shops in Gastown , but please don ’ t ask me the names , because I never remember !
Style mantra Invest in timeless pieces . Invest wisely , in the quality and the tailoring . They will last you forever . Disposable income goes towards the accessories .
Essential tour of Vancouver Stanley Park is a must . And a walk along English Bay . Granville Island is a special place . Deer Lake is a great spot to pack a picnic in the summer . You ’ ll be blown away by Gastown : do a walking tour , get a perspective on the city ’ s history , and grab a cocktail .
Best view of Vancouver Walk the seawall .
